Abstract

The device (100) has a head structure i.e. pair of glasses (102), to be worn on the head of a user, and a pico projector (116) fixed to the pair of glasses to project images in front of the user when the user uses the glasses. A micro-camera (118) is fixed to the glasses to capture the images projected by the pico projector on a background. An analyzing unit (124) analyzes the images captured by the micro-camera, and a control unit (126) controls the pico projector according to the analysis of the analyzing unit.
